About Chia‐Ing Li

Chia‐Ing Li is a scholar working on Geriatrics and Gerontology, Endocrinology, Diabetes and Metabolism, Nephrology, Periodontics and Otorhinolaryngology, having authored 86 papers that have together received 1.4k indexed citations. Recurring topics across this work include Diabetes, Cardiovascular Risks, and Lipoproteins (16 papers), Nutrition and Health in Aging (16 papers), Frailty in Older Adults (12 papers), Diabetes Management and Research (10 papers), Liver Disease Diagnosis and Treatment (9 papers), Chronic Kidney Disease and Diabetes (8 papers), Blood Pressure and Hypertension Studies (7 papers) and Cardiovascular Health and Disease Prevention (7 papers). The work is most often cited by research in Geriatrics and Gerontology (178 citations), Endocrinology, Diabetes and Metabolism (318 citations), Periodontics (75 citations), Physiology (348 citations) and Family Practice (22 citations). Chia‐Ing Li has collaborated with scholars based in Taiwan, United States and China. Frequent co-authors include Tsai‐Chung Li, Cheng‐Chieh Lin, Chiu-Shong Liu, Wen‐Yuan Lin, Chih‐Hsueh Lin, Shih‐Wei Lai, Kuan‐Fu Liao, Ching‐Chu Chen, Shing-Yu Yang and Wen‐Chi Chen. Their work appears in journals such as Scientific Reports, BMC Public Health, Medicine, BMC Geriatrics and PLoS ONE.
